  dimensions in inches and (millimeters) version: a06 fr301 - fr307 3.0 amps. fast recovery rectifiers do-201ad features  high efficiency, low vf  high current capability  high reliability  high surge current capability  low power loss. mechanical data  cases: molded plastic  epoxy: ul 94v-0 rate flame retardant  lead: pure tin plated, lead free., solderable per mil-std- 202, method 208 guaranteed  polarity: color band denotes cathode end  high temperature soldering guaranteed: 260 o c/10 seconds/.375?, ( 9.5mm ) lead lengths at 5 lbs.,(2.3kg) tension  weight: 1.2 grams maximum ratings and electrical characteristics rating at 25 o c ambient temperature unless otherwise specified. single phase, half wave, 60 hz, resistive or inductive load. for capac itive load, derate current by 20% type number symbol fr 301 fr 302 fr 303 fr 304 fr 305 fr 306 fr 307 units maximum recurrent peak reverse voltage v rrm 50 100 200 400 600 800 1000 v maximum rms voltage v rms 35 70 140 280 420 560 700 v maximum dc blocking voltage v dc 50 100 200 400 600 800 1000 v maximum average forward rectified current .375?(9.5mm) lead length @t a = 55 o c i (av) 3.0 a peak forward surge current, 8.3 ms single half sine-wave superimposed on rated load (jedec method ) i fsm 150 a maximum instantaneous forward voltage @ 3.0a v f 1.2 v maximum dc reverse current @ t a =25 o c at rated dc blocking voltage @ t a =125 o c i r 5 150 ua ua maximum reverse recovery time ( note 1) trr 150 250 500 ns typical junction capacitance ( note 2 ) cj 60 pf typical thermal resistance (note 3) r ja 40 o c/w operating temperature range t j -65 to +150 o c storage temperature range t stg -65 to +150 o c notes: 1. reverse recovery test conditions: i f =0.5a, i r =1.0a, i rr =0.25a 2. measured at 1 mhz and applied reverse voltage of 4.0 volts d.c. 3. mount on cu-pad size 16mm x 16mm on p.c.b.
